Not according to the fine print on xbox.com

Free Quantum Break Windows 10 game offer valid with pre-order of digital copy of Quantum Break for Xbox One, by April 4, 2016, from Xbox Store, Xbox.com, participating retailers, or inside Quantum Break Xbox One console bundles, while supplies last (physical game discs and bundles with Quantum Break game discs are excluded from this offer). Quantum Break Xbox One codes purchased at retail and inside bundles must be redeemed on the console or at Xbox.com by April 4, 2016 11.59 PM Pacific Time. Windows 10 game redemption code will be sent via Xbox system message around the week of April 5, 2016. (In US, UK and Canada, codes with pre-order of the Xbox One Special Edition Quantum Break Bundle can be redeemed by April 10th, 2016, 11.59 PM Pacific Time.) For Windows 10 game system requirements see

And here http://www.quantumbreak.com/windows10/

Starting February 11, anyone who pre-orders the digital version of “Quantum Break” for Xbox One through the Xbox Store will receive the Windows 10 version of the game for free, downloadable at the Windows Store via redemption code. The pre-order offer also applies for those who redeem a digital code purchased from participating retailers or from the Xbox One Special Edition Quantum Break Bundle by April 5, 2016.
